Gangsters stab and badly mutilate the face of a female KCA university student, Kenyans react with anger, despair

A female university student is fighting for her life in hospital after gangsters stabbed her severally on the face leaving it mutilated after she resisted a robbery outside KCA university on Thika road.

Reports say the student was almost killed were it not for her reaction to run away when she was accosted by the thugs armed with knives.

A quick intervention by nearby police officers also helped her and was later taken to hospital bleeding profusely from the cuts inflicted by the gangsters.

As the lawlessness facing Nairobi escalated irate Kenyans castigated the government for paying lip service to insecurity that is steadily running out of control.

The deadly attack on the student (pictured above) came only a day after Internal Security Cabinet Secretary Kithure Kindiki warned thugs that the government was coming for them.

It also came a day after the Directorate of Criminal Investigations (DCI) announced that it had arrested three notorious robbers who have been robbing and terrorizing people around KCA university.
